FG Brands pairs Bare&Sol and facial collective under one Birmingham roof, then opens the shared-lease format to franchisees nationwide.

FG Brands has opened what it calls the beauty franchise industry's first dual-concept studio, combining its Bare&Sol and facial collective brands inside one Birmingham, Alabama location. The Cahaba Village Plaza studio has served that community since 2013 and was remodeled this year to house both brands under a single lease and staff. It now counts more than 1,000 members across the two brands, with a meaningful share holding memberships in both.
The pitch to franchisees is straightforward: facial collective handles facial care and aesthetics, Bare&Sol handles hair removal and airbrush tanning, and neither brand dilutes its specialty by absorbing the other's services. Sharing one lease and one team lowers the fixed cost of running two membership businesses instead of one, while the combined foot traffic gives each brand a built-in cross-sell audience.
Co-locating two focused, membership-based concepts is a different growth lever than the usual playbook of opening more single-brand units or bolting extra services onto an existing store. FG Brands is now offering the Birmingham format to franchisees nationwide, turning one successful pilot into a second product it can sell alongside its standalone Bare&Sol and facial collective territories.
For operators already juggling several service brands, the dual-concept format offers a way to consolidate real estate and staffing costs without stretching either brand's identity thin. Whether other franchisors copy the approach will depend on how well Birmingham's membership numbers hold up once the novelty wears off.
